Many members in my community are poor. According to poverty experts and research by the American Psychological Association, students who are living in poverty are more likely to complete fewer years of education. The group of students that I am teaching will not be a part of that statistic. They will understand that education is the key to success, and they must not fear it. Each and every one of my awesome students is unique and intelligent. The world underestimates them and believes that they cannot become outstanding adults with their own ideas; outstanding adults who are independent thinkers. Nonetheless, my students enter my classroom with a hidden passion to learn and explore, but they only bring it out when their learning environment is welcoming to them and their unique growth. With help, I want ensure that they push themselves beyond the limitation that society has placed on them. They will accomplish this by having access to various reading resources and also technology
